"I never expected we would get him on the show" Matt Damon has surprised listeners on a Dublin radio show after agreeing to do an online interview from lockdown.

You can listen to the interview below. For weeks, the presenter of the Dublin breakfast programme, Nathan O’Reilly, had sent interview requests to Damon’s agent after learning that the Hollywood actor was staying in the city.

Damon had flown into Dublin with his family to film The Last Duel – a film by Ridley Scott. However, almost immediately after arriving, production on the film was shut down and travel restrictions imposed following the outbreak of the coronavirus pandemic.
